Affordable Online Marketing Tactics for Small Businesses With Small Budgets

In difficult times, it may be impossible for you to focus on marketing with everything going on. Keeping your marketing efforts going is a must if you want your business to remain competitive and stay afloat.

Here are some affordable, online marketing tactics you can employ without breaking the bank:

1. Start a Blog

There are plenty of professional content creators that can do this for you and keep your online and social media presence humming along. 

Blog articles are a simple, low cost way to drive traffic to your website by providing and sharing valuable content with your social media followers. As far as unpaid ways to create traffic, blogging should be one of the tools in your tool bag. Just keep in mind that consistency and frequency (in addition to relevant content) is needed to start developing a following and increasing your search engine rankings.

2. Stay active on social media

Consistency is the key. If you don’t have the time or patience to post relevant and valuable content to your followers, hire a social media marketing professional who can create and execute a basic, affordable social media strategy to ensure you remain in front of customers on at least one of the main social media platforms. Make sure they provide you with regular reports of the information you will need to make smart decisions about how and where to spend your hard-earned marketing dollars.

3. Create a Facebook Business Page

A Facebook Business page is a completely different animal from a personal page. It is all about promoting your business. A Facebook business page is one of the best ways to connect with your customers and build a following for your company.

4. Start a YouTube Channel and post videos

Creating a quick, informative video about your products or services does not require expensive equipment or professional editing. It can be done with your smartphone and an app that can create a marketing video that will attract and engage your audience. Then share your videos on your social media channels to further your organic reach and grow your audience. 

You can take it one step further by taking advantage of LIVE streaming services like Facebook Live to engage your audience further and faster. Most users enjoy the live-action and unedited approach to live videos. This means you don’t need a fancy camera, set design or editing skills. Facebook Live is all about living in the moment.

5. Create More Lead Magnets with Email Marketing

Email marketing is one of the lowest-cost, highest ROI marketing tactics ANY business can employ to bring back customers who haven’t heard from you in a long time. Use your website to collect emails through forms, landing pages, free trials and discount promotions. 

Budgets are tight everywhere, but that doesn’t mean you cannot market your business effectively and cost-consciously during these leaner times. Try some of the above techniques to help your business continue to gain new followers, traffic to your website and customers to your door.
